Nyassa sylvatica - black gum

Latin name:
Nyssa sylvatica "biflora"
Common name:
Tupelo
Keywords:
black gum, tupelo

Likes deep moisture soils and preferably shelter from wind and hot direct sun.
Is deciduous and Autumn colours are red, yellow and orange.
Ideal for planting on the edges of ponds or lakes.
Hardy
